Residents of River Park benefit from strong public schools within the Tri Cities High School cluster, including Tri Cities High School, Paul D West Middle School, and Parklane Elementary. These schools serve the neighborhood and form an important part of the local identity, with families often choosing River Park specifically for the school district and the sense of continuity it provides for children from elementary through high school. Proximity to these schools also supports morning routines that are walkable and community activities that bring neighbors together.

The location of River Park is one of its biggest assets. Close to downtown East Point and just a short drive or MARTA ride from downtown Atlanta, residents have easy access to dining, arts, and employment centers across the metro area. Frequent transit options, main thoroughfares, and proximity to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port make commuting and regional travel straightforward.
